Anti-miR-10b antagomir is a chemically modified antisense oligonucleotide designed to inhibit the oncogenic microRNA-10b (miR-10b). miR-10b is significantly upregulated in high-grade gliomas, including glioblastoma multiforme (GBM), and is associated with poor patient prognosis. It plays a critical role in promoting tumor cell migration, invasion, and the maintenance of glioblastoma stem cells. The antagomir typically consists of a 2-O-methyl-modified RNA sequence that is perfectly complementary to miR-10b and often conjugated to cholesterol to enhance cellular uptake and stability. By sequestering miR-10b, the antagomir restores the expression of downstream tumor suppressor targets, thereby inhibiting the invasive phenotype of GBM cells and reducing tumor growth in preclinical models.
